Abstract

Simulation-based verification is still one of the most important methods to validate the correctness of System-on-Chips. Here, explicitly specified stimuli need to be generated which trigger certain scenarios of the design. However, so far stimuli generation is mainly performed independently of the desired coverage. In this work, we propose approaches for coverage-driven stimuli generation. Despite a naive method, we introduce and discuss automatic and interactive methods for an improved stimuli generation. We show that explicitly considering coverage metrics leads to smaller and complete sets of stimuli.
